Mr. Dell

The required information for all countries that are members of the United Nations would involve disproportionate time and effort; the average of the daily exchange rates of the major currencies in January 1970 and February 1976 were as follows:

January 1970 February 1976 Percentage depreciation (-) or appreciation (+)
United States dollar 2.4005 2.0262 -15.6
Canadian dollar 2.5755 2.0142 -21.8
Belgian franc 119.25 79.23 -33.6
Swiss franc 10.356 5.2042 -49.7
French franc 13.329 9.0614 -32.0
Italian lira 1,510.0 1,554.42 + 2.9
Netherlands guilder 8.720 5.395 -38.1
Deutschemark 8.849 5.188 -41.4
Swedish kronor 12.399 8.861 -28.5
Norwegian kroner 17.162 11.188 -34.8
Danish kronor 17.990 12.440 -30.9
Austrian schilling 62.08 37.03 -40.4
Portuguese escudos 68.32 55.60 -18.6
Japanese yen 858.61 610.97 -28.8
